Rotunda Tour

Picture of Rotunda Tour

Olympia has a rich history as our State Capitol. Begin with a visit the Washington State Capitol Building. The Rotunda and Legislative Building are remarkable with every inch in beautiful granite. Inside you’ll also see the largest Tiffany chandelier collection in the world during your 50 minute tour.

Hands On Children's Museum

Picture of Hands On Children's Museum
414 Jefferson St NE, Olympia, WA 98501, USA
(360) 956-0818

The award-winning Hands On Children's Museum is the largest and most visited children's museum in the Pacific Northwest. We celebrate play and believe in its importance in early learning. With over 150 exciting exhibits in 10 beautiful galleries and a fabulous art studio, we encourage children and their parents to play and learn all about science, nature, and art in settings inspired by our beautiful Northwest. Our Outdoor Discovery Center, a half-acre of unique outdoor exhibits, expands opportunities for play and learning with a trike and hike loop, lighthouse lookout, Puget Sound beach replica, children's garden, and Megan D schooner where kids can climb a six-foot rope ladder to the top deck of a real 56-foot vintage schooner, cross the rickety bridge, explore the crow's nest, and captain the ship. Billy Frank Jr. Nisqually National Wildlife Refuge

Picture of Billy Frank Jr. Nisqually National Wildlife Refuge
100 Brown Farm Rd NE, Olympia, WA 98516, USA
(360) 753-9467

Located on the Nisqually River Delta in Southern Puget Sound, this refuge consists of three thousand acres of salt and freshwater marshes, grasslands and mixed forest habitats that provide a resting and nesting area for a wide variety of migratory birds.
